Subject: Quickstore 4.2 — bloom filter now fronts the KV layer

Plugin authors: starting with this release, Quickstore places a bloom filter ahead of the key-value store. Negative lookups return faster; false positives fall through safely. No API changes are required on your side. Verify your plugin against the staging build referenced below.

session token of fahif-tadup = htk3_9c7

## Tuning

Deploybot Pebble polls the release pipeline and posts status to chat channels. Polling too aggressively rate-limits us; too slowly, engineers miss failed deploys. Each constant below has been validated against the Marrowgate staging pipeline, so change them one at a time. The current production values are listed here.

tuning constants:
QUOTAS = {
    "druwyn": 5,
    "holix": 5,
    "zorath": 5,
    "holwyn": 10,
}

Handover note — Crumbwheel order cutoffs.

Welcome aboard. The bakery cutoff rule in Crumbwheel closes same-day orders at 14:00 local to each storefront, not UTC — this has bitten us twice. Holiday overrides live in the calendar service and take precedence silently, so always check there first when a cutoff looks wrong. To unlock the calendar service's admin console after a restart, enter the recovery passphrase below.

vault phrase of bagap-bahaf = silion-pelox-sorox-casdor-quenwyn-fraax-eliox-praael-kelion-quenvan-kasox-rusael-norius-belvan

# feedcheck-validator env
# Validates episode feeds for the Mossbell podcast network:
# enclosure sizes, duration tags, and artwork dimensions.
# Reviewers: run `feedcheck --dry` before approving rule changes.
# CACHE_TTL and STRICT_MODE are safe to tweak locally.
# The validator posts results to the reporting service, which
# requires the token set on the next line.

vault entry, yahaf-tagug: LEDGER_TOKEN20=884d77d1a8b98aa4edfb

## Break-Glass: Conversion Rounding Audit

If the Marivel ledger shows rounding drift above 0.5 basis points in currency conversion, break-glass access to the rate-adjustment console is authorized. Document the drift amount, affected pairs, and reviewer approval before proceeding. To unseal the console, the steward must supply the recovery passphrase recorded below.

vault phrase of kahip-bajog = praath-gordor-juleth-istys-quenion